Think Like a Programmer: The Ultimate Guide to Programming Success
4.7 out of 5
Language | : | English |
File size | : | 8031 KB |
Text-to-Speech | : | Enabled |
Screen Reader | : | Supported |
Enhanced typesetting | : | Enabled |
Print length | : | 256 pages |
In today's digital age, programming is more important than ever before. From self-driving cars to artificial intelligence, programming is at the heart of many of the most groundbreaking technologies. But what exactly is programming, and how can you learn to do it?
Think Like a Programmer is a comprehensive guide to learning how to think like a programmer. With over 3000 words of insightful content, this book will teach you the fundamental principles of programming, from problem-solving to data structures and algorithms. Whether you're a complete beginner or an experienced programmer, Think Like a Programmer will help you take your programming skills to the next level.
What is Programming?
Programming is the process of creating instructions for a computer to follow. These instructions can be used to do a wide variety of tasks, from simple calculations to complex simulations. Programming languages are the tools that programmers use to create these instructions.
There are many different programming languages, each with its own strengths and weaknesses. Some of the most popular programming languages include Python, Java, C++, and JavaScript.
How to Think Like a Programmer
The first step to learning how to program is to learn how to think like a programmer. This means being able to break down problems into smaller, more manageable pieces. It also means being able to see the big picture and understand how different parts of a program fit together.
Here are a few tips for thinking like a programmer:
- Start by solving simple problems
- Break down problems into smaller pieces
- Use a structured approach to problem-solving
- Test your code regularly
- Don't be afraid to ask for help
The Fundamental Principles of Programming
Once you've learned how to think like a programmer, you can start to learn the fundamental principles of programming. These principles include:
- Data types
- Variables
- Operators
- Control flow
- Functions
These principles are the building blocks of all programming languages. Once you understand these principles, you'll be able to start writing your own programs.
Data Structures and Algorithms
Data structures and algorithms are two of the most important concepts in programming. Data structures are used to organize and store data. Algorithms are used to process data.
There are many different types of data structures and algorithms. The most common data structures include arrays, lists, stacks, queues, and trees. The most common algorithms include sorting algorithms, searching algorithms, and graph algorithms.
Understanding data structures and algorithms is essential for writing efficient and effective programs.
Think Like a Programmer is the ultimate guide to learning how to think like a programmer. With over 3000 words of insightful content, this book will teach you the fundamental principles of programming, from problem-solving to data structures and algorithms. Whether you're a complete beginner or an experienced programmer, Think Like a Programmer will help you take your programming skills to the next level.
Click here to Free Download your copy of Think Like a Programmer today!
4.7 out of 5
Language | : | English |
File size | : | 8031 KB |
Text-to-Speech | : | Enabled |
Screen Reader | : | Supported |
Enhanced typesetting | : | Enabled |
Print length | : | 256 pages |
Do you want to contribute by writing guest posts on this blog?
Please contact us and send us a resume of previous articles that you have written.
- Book
- Novel
- Page
- Chapter
- Text
- Story
- Genre
- Reader
- Library
- Paperback
- E-book
- Magazine
- Newspaper
- Paragraph
- Sentence
- Bookmark
- Shelf
- Glossary
- Bibliography
- Foreword
- Preface
- Synopsis
- Annotation
- Footnote
- Manuscript
- Scroll
- Codex
- Tome
- Bestseller
- Classics
- Library card
- Narrative
- Biography
- Autobiography
- Memoir
- Reference
- Encyclopedia
- Norman Franks
- The Car Crash Detective
- Kris Wilder
- Walter Enders
- Mary H K Choi
- Neil Bimbeau
- Sam Dogra
- Mikael Svenson
- Patrice Leleu
- Skye Genaro
- Tahmina Watson
- Wendy Higgins
- Marsha Vanwynsberghe
- Paul F Robinson
- Seraphina Nova Glass
- Neil J Salkind
- Seth Stein
- Morgan Rice
- Marc Sedaka
- Robin Riley
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!
- Enrique BlairFollow ·6.7k
- Ernest HemingwayFollow ·5.1k
- Elton HayesFollow ·3.5k
- Ira CoxFollow ·17.8k
- Orson Scott CardFollow ·8.4k
- Gavin MitchellFollow ·16.3k
- Beau CarterFollow ·9.7k
- Charles DickensFollow ·10.9k
The Beginner's Guide to Making an Old Motor Run Forever
If you're like most...
Nepali Adventure: Kings and Elephant Drivers,...
In the heart of the...
The Romantic Revolution: A Journey Through History and...
Unveiling the...
Unlock Your Inner Innovator: Dive into the New Wave...
Embark on a Transformative Journey of...
Crazy Horse: The Lakota Warrior's Life and Legacy
In the annals of Native...
Mildred and Richard Loving: The Inspiring Story of...
Mildred and Richard Loving were an...
4.7 out of 5
Language | : | English |
File size | : | 8031 KB |
Text-to-Speech | : | Enabled |
Screen Reader | : | Supported |
Enhanced typesetting | : | Enabled |
Print length | : | 256 pages |